Mudslide
Vodka, Kahlúa, and Baileys — improvised at Grand Cayman's Rum Point Club in the 1970s, TGI Fridays' frozen blending making it a defining American dessert cocktail.
- 1 ozvodka
- 1 ozcoffee liqueur
- 1 ozirish cream liqueur
- 1 ozchocolate syrup
- 1 cupice(for blending)
- chocolate drizzle and whipped creamgarnish
- 1Add vodka and coffee liqueur and Irish cream and chocolate syrup and ice to a blender.
- 2Blend until smooth and thick.
- 3Pour into a hurricane glass drizzled with chocolate.
- 4Top with whipped cream and more chocolate drizzle.

The Mudslide is most consistently traced to the Wreck Bar at the Rum Point Club on Grand Cayman island in the Cayman Islands during the 1970s, where a bartender improvised the drink using the ingredients at hand: vodka, Kahlua, and Baileys Irish Cream. Baileys, launched in 1974 as the world's first commercial Irish cream liqueur, was still a novelty when the Mudslide was reportedly created, and its combination with vodka and Kahlua produced an unexpectedly rich, dessert-quality cocktail. TGI Fridays popularized a frozen blended ice cream version during the 1980s and 1990s, transforming the Mudslide from a beach specialty into one of America's most recognized dessert cocktails. The Mudslide's name references the earthen color of the coffee-cream combination and the irresistible momentum of a drink that slides down easily despite its considerable richness.
